Vilsack addresses food insecurity and USDA next steps

Ag Secretary Tom Vilsack says to address the issue of hunger, USDA must work in concert with the food and agriculture industries to begin the process of transforming the food system.

“The fact is we spend $160 billion as a federal government through Medicaid and Medicare on diabetes, which is significantly greater than the entire budget of the Department of Agriculture. And much of that diabetes issue is directly connected to food insecurity and nutrition insecurity.”

Vilsack said during a webinar Wednesday hosted by the National Press Foundation his department will focus on expanding and improving federal nutrition programs, and making healthy and nutritious foods more available.

“For our children, for our families that are financially stressed, and for socially disadvantaged individuals.”

Vilsack says USDA also has to do a better job of educating consumers across the board about healthy food choices.
